Our Story

M.I.K.I.D. Mentally Ill Kids In Distress was founded in 1987 by Sue Gilbertson, driven by the need for better services for children facing mental health challenges. What began as a small support group has blossomed into Arizona's largest family-run behavioral health organization, now extending its vital services into Colorado.

Impact on Families

With over 150 trained staff members, M.I.K.I.D. provides essential education, resources, and support to families navigating emotional and behavioral challenges. The organization emphasizes a family-centered approach, ensuring that families are empowered and involved in their children's mental health journey.
